Allegra Ripolli is a pioneering surgeon and researcher whose work is reshaping the landscape of minimally invasive pancreatic surgery. Her primary research areas center on robotic pancreatoduodenectomy (RPD), a highly complex procedure for treating pancreatic and periampullary tumors. Ripolli’s major contributions include advancing the technical frontiers of RPD, particularly in cases involving superior mesenteric/portal vein resection and reconstruction—a challenging scenario often required after neoadjuvant therapy. Her 2023 paper, “Tips and tricks for robotic pancreatoduodenectomy with superior mesenteric/portal vein resection and reconstruction,” has garnered 37 citations, establishing it as a key resource for surgeons. She also developed the PD-ROBOSCORE, a novel difficulty scoring system for RPD (34 citations), which enables safe, stepwise implementation of the procedure by predicting postoperative complications. Additionally, her work on instrumentless liver suspension for retraction (2024) showcases her commitment to refining surgical ergonomics and reducing invasiveness.
